About Älvsbyn
Älvsbyn is a locality and the seat of Älvsbyn Municipality in Norrbotten County, Sweden with 4,967 inhabitants in 2010. It is known as "The Pearl of Norrbotten".

Monthly Weather
| Month | Avg Temperature | Precipitation | Summary |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 13°F (-11°C) | 1.5 in | Coldest |
| February | 14°F (-10°C) | 1.1 in | |
| March | 23°F (-5°C) | 1.2 in | |
| April | 33°F (1°C) | 1.1 in | Driest |
| May | 45°F (7°C) | 1.4 in | |
| June | 56°F (13°C) | 2.0 in | |
| July | 60°F (15°C) | 2.9 in | Warmest, Wettest |
| August | 56°F (13°C) | 2.9 in | |
| September | 46°F (8°C) | 2.2 in | |
| October | 35°F (2°C) | 1.9 in | |
| November | 23°F (-5°C) | 1.9 in | |
| December | 16°F (-9°C) | 1.5 in |
Älvsbyn has a seasonal temperature swing of 47°F / from 13°F in January to 60°F in July. Total annual precipitation is 21.4 inches, with July being the wettest month (2.9") and April the driest (1.1").
